The EDX 680 is a benchtop energy-dispersive XRF spectrometer with a Si-PIN detector and an efficient X-ray excitation source, meeting the requirements of precious-metal composition control. A modern enclosure, a clear high-resolution sample-observation system and user-friendly software make everyday work easier.
Applications
- Quality-control centers and testing laboratories
- Jewelry-processing workshops and jewelry shops
- Pawnshops and precious-metal buying and recycling points
- Precious-metal refineries
